In addition to the complex motions possible with the teams apparatus, they conducted their experiment in a wooded setting similar to the flys natural environment, adding to the complexity and realism of the experiment.

Nemenman and his colleagues research is significant because it re-examines fundamental assumptions that became the basis of neuromimetic approaches to artificial intelligence, such as artificial neural networks. These assumptions have developed networks based on reacting to a number of impulses within a given time period rather than the precise timing of those impulses.

This may be one of the main reasons why artificial neural networks do not perform anywhere comparable to a mammalian visual brain, said Nemenman, who is a member of Los Alamos Computer, Computational and Statistical Sciences Division. In fact, the National Science Foundation has recognized the importance of this distinction and has recently funded a project, led by Garrett Kenyon of the Laboratorys Physics Division, to enable creation of large, next-generation neural networks.

New understanding of neural function in the design of computers could assist in analyses of satellite images and facial-pattern recognition in high-security environments, and could help solve other national and global security problems.
